Item description for Bktrax-Disc-Captivating (Unabrdg) (7 CD) by John Eldredge, Stasi Eldredge & John Eldredge...
"You belong among the wildflowers You belong in a boat out at sea You belong with your love on your arm You belong somewhere you feel free. -- Tom Petty Read by bestselling author John Eldredge and his wife and co-author, Stasi, this is the unveiling of the beauty and mystery of the feminine soul. Captivating shows readers the three core desires of every woman's heart----to be romanced, to play an irreplaceable role in a grand adventure, and to unveil beauty.
Every little girl has dreams of being swept up into a great adventure, of being the beautiful princess. Sadly, when women grow up, they are often swept up into a life filled merely with duty and demands. Many Christian women are tired, struggling under the weight of the pressure to be a "good servant," a nurturing caregiver, or a capable home manager.
Stasi writes,
"I love the sentence "Sometimes, it's hard to be a woman" from the old Tammy Wynette song. Talk about an understatement. Yes, there are many, many times when it is very hard to be a man as well. Yet, we women are living in a time when the pressures from without and the pressures from within to live well as a woman often feel massive and relentless. Sometimes, it's harder to be a woman."
What Wild at Heart did for men, Captivating can do for women. This groundbreaking book shows readers the glorious design of women before the fall, describes how the feminine heart can be restored, and casts a vision for the power, freedom, and beauty of a woman released to be all she was meant to be. John and Stasi Eldredge invite women to recover their feminine hearts, created in the image of an intimate and passionate God. Further, they encourage men to discover the secret of a woman's soul and to delight in the beauty and strength women were created to offer.

CAPTIVATING: UNVEILING THE MYSTERY OF A WOMAN's SOUL serves as evidence of the epidemic of confused ideation which unfortunately, finds its way into print.
The perennial faults, common to New Age literature, [The CARTESIAN AFFLICTION & The ERROR OF ECCLECTICISM, are made evident in this book, by authors claiming vaguely, to be "Christian".
Even the title reference, concerning "A WOMAN's SOUL" more than suggests that the SOUL is itself SEXED, or qualified by a gender, and this would specifically make the book unChristian in its theological foundations. In Christian theology, there is no such thing as a SOUL being feminized or masculinized.
One can only wonder what system of Checks & Balances such author use, or failed to use, as they compare their proposals to valid propositions.
Philosophically, the core difficulty concerns the issue of human IDENTITY. The authors fail to identify SOUL as the human identity, and opt instead for a modernist interpretation of being founded upon SEXUAL IDENTITY. Therefore, if I am born male, my identity is that of a male, rather than that of a SOUL.
This fault established, the foundation for nearly everything the authors write is not only weak in its rationality, it is contradictory to even the most simple and basic of Christian doctrine, regardless of whether the reader is either Catholic, Protestant, or any other sect.
